Executive Assistant to Chief Operating Officer

4 months ago


Wellington City, New Zealand New Zealand Government Full time

Fantastic Executive Assistant (EA) opportunity with a strong business advisory focus, supporting a senior leader to deliver in a fun, high-performance environment.
- Are you looking for a senior leader support role with a twist?
- Do you thrive on varied and challenging work?
- Do you have an optimistic outlook with the desire to learn?
- Do you want to work in an organisation that is making NZ a better place for people today and in the future?

Mō mātou | About Us
At Te Tai Ōhanga - The Treasury, we are committed to Tiakitanga to make Aotearoa a better place for people today and in the future. We safeguard New Zealand's finances and are the Government's trusted economic advisor. Our vision is to lift living standards for all New Zealanders.
We are looking for an EA with a strong business advisory focus to support the Chief Operating Officer and Deputy Secretary, Strategy, Performance and Change (COO). The COO heads the Corporate and Shared Services group at Te Tai Ōhanga and is responsible for the delivery of corporate services to Treasury and other shared services to key departments (such as DPMC and NEMA) as well as leading the Strengthening the Treasury programme (our key change programme) for the Treasury.
Kōrero mō te tūranga | About the Role
This role is a hybrid role in which you cover standard EA responsibilities, alongside additional advisory duties for the COO. You'll have the opportunity to work closely with the COO to help set the strategy and priorities for the group, and act on behalf to deliver to them. This role provides a high degree of autonomy and the chance to get further involved in areas of interest.
It's a great opportunity for an experienced administrator with a strategic mindset to further progress their career and gain advisory experience, or for a recent graduate with at least 1-2 years of office experience to further develop a broad skillset within a central agency.
To be successful in the role, you'll have a previous track record of achieving results, building positive stakeholder relationships, and showing strategic capability. You'll possess the ability to work under pressure and manage multiple complex priorities. You will also be a highly organised self-starter, with strong attention to detail and comfort dealing with ambiguity.
If you want to be a key advisor to a senior leader and you are committed to delivering a high standard of administrative support, continuously thinking about how you can improve processes and achieve outcomes, and are known for being one-step ahead, then this is the opportunity for you
Ō pūmanawa | About You
- An ability and interest in working with the COO to set the strategic direction
- Exemplary organisational skills and sound judgement to anticipate, coordinate, and execute requirements for meetings and ensure the COO is fully prepared for all their commitments
- Excellent relationship management and interpersonal skills underpinned by strong written and oral communication abilities
- Experience being adaptable, working calmly under pressure, and anticipating and resolving problems with a can-do approach
- Tech savviness, with strong MS office skills and the ability to pick up new systems quickly
